Output abab286f52a0224d3f159a57790a39b2d7e5a0bbca256c8d17e4528a51099778:13

value
2560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8af1d54e4122e81f88199b5941f3bdec1501671 OP_EQUAL
address
3H4wDwnQpC4HqJZYnbYfWHRKY3sVmNDuiC
transaction
abab286f52a0224d3f159a57790a39b2d7e5a0bbca256c8d17e4528a51099778
spent
true